Wantyourfeedback.com's availability has been inspected 0 times in the 0 days from November 24, 2024, until now. As of November 24, 2024, all tests indicate that wantyourfeedback.com was either down or having issues. Wantyourfeedback.com did not encounter any unavailability issues during tests carried out as of November 24, 2024. It has been confirmed that all responses received as of November 24, 2024, do not indicate any error statuses. Records show the November 24, 2024, wantyourfeedback.com response at 0 seconds, contrasted with the 0.000 seconds average.